摘要
园林树木网络数据库系统采用三层结构设计,即程序逻辑结构分为用户界面层、业务逻辑处理层和数据存储层。三层在实际的物理结构上也是独立的。业务逻辑处理层负责与数据库的连接,它包含与数据库连接的JavaBean,分别为植物学查询Bean、生物学特性及观赏特性查询Bean。所有的数据库操作均由用户界面层调用相应的JavaBean来完成,提高了系统的安全性和可移植性。用户界面层负责返回用户查询所得的结果。查询中采用输入关键词→粗略查询→详细查询和图片查询的逻辑进程,大大提高了查询的速度和效率。
The network database of landscape trees was designed as the three-stratum structure comprised of user interface stratum,logical processing stratum of business,and data storing stratum.The three stratums were independent their actual physical structures.The logical processing stratum of business was responsible for the link to the database and thus included the JavaBean demanded,which were consisted of search Bean for botany,biological bean and ornamental features bean.All the database operations were completed by applying for the corresponding JavaBean with the help of the user interface stratum,therefore greatly improving the security and transplant ability of the system.The user interface stratum took charge of returning the results of the user's query.In searching process,by introducing the logical steps of keywords input→wide scan→accurate location and pictures searching,it enormously enhanced the rate and efficiency of an query.
